A beneficial “cash advance” is that loan off quick course, always two weeks, which have exorbitant interest levels

The brand new payday loan world stimulates vast amounts of dollars a-year. States is cracking down on payday loan providers, while the industry is regulated in the usa in which it is nevertheless court.

Payday lenders require you to furnish a copy of your own driver’s license, and you will information regarding the a career and you can bank accounts. The mortgage is frequently for many months (the full time until your future salary). The lenders do not create a credit assessment, while create him or her an article-old seek out extent we would like to acquire including good percentage. The price is usually a beneficial “borrowing” payment and you can a merchant account place-upwards fee. In the event the checking account do not protection the level of the mortgage, you may then owe the initial loan including extra interest. You’ll be able to happen overdraft charges from your own financial. Knowing you simply cannot repay the mortgage over the years, you could potentially pay the credit charges (otherwise funds charges) to help you replenish the loan. The fresh annual percentage rate (APR) to possess an online payday loan usually begins more 400 percent! That it behavior brings a pattern from consumer refinancing and you will continuing debt.

Cash advance are generally illegal in Georgia, until created by a lender authorized by Georgia’s Agencies out-of Financial and Funds, however some loan providers get qualify for exclusion of licensure. Questions regarding a cost mortgage licensee will be led into Georgia Institution off Financial and you can Finance. Loan providers try susceptible to new terms and you may constraints from Georgia’s Fees Financing Operate (O.C.Grams.Good. § 7-3-step 1 ainsi que seq.), Pay day Credit Work (O.C.G.An excellent. § 16-17-step one et seq.), and usury rules (O.C.G.A. 7-4-step one mais aussi seq.).

The fresh government Basic facts from inside the Financing Operate needs revelation of one’s pricing of borrowing. A borrower need certainly to receive, written down, the latest financing charge (a dollar matter) and Apr, which is the price of borrowing from the bank yearly. Pay check loan providers was susceptible to so it control.

Usury legislation reduce interest amount a lender can charge. From inside the Georgia, an authorized lender cannot charge over 10% desire towards financing out of $step 3,100000 otherwise reduced. Most claims has actually good usury limitation; if you decided to borrow funds off an out-of-condition financial institution, that state’s cover would pertain.   • Georgia victims out-of a pay day financial will be go after criminal step as a consequence of their regional district lawyer otherwise solicitor.
  • Georgia victims might also want to declaration new event for the Georgia Agencies away from Financial and you may Money.

  • Georgia sufferers must also statement the experience the user Attract Point of the Georgia Attorneys General’s Place of work of the mail just. Know that the latest Attorneys General’s Place of work will not do it facing illegal pay day lenders with respect to anyone consumer, however, serves for the benefit of the condition of Georgia because a complete. At exactly the same time, it cannot bring customers legal advice by what steps when planning on taking that have unlawful lenders. The shipped issue will likely be submitted to:

  • Any target who believes that bank broken the scenario when you look at the Lending Work is document a complaint with the Federal Change Payment (FTC). An on-line function is present on issue. The newest FTC try not to resolve individual dilemmas, but should be able to operate if this discovers a pattern off abuses.

  • Create an authentic funds and you may shape their month-to-month and you may day-after-day costs to eliminate so many instructions.
  • Contact your local consumer credit guidance service, borrowing connection, or nonprofit credit counseling provider if you would like let believed good finances.
  • Intend on using only one mastercard to have instructions which means you can be restrict your loans and you can song the expenses.
  • Check out the supply of overdraft cover on the checking account.
  • Evaluate also offers when looking for credit to see borrowing which have the lowest Annual percentage rate and you will lowest financing charges.
  • Query financial institutions to get more time and energy to pay their debts, and get whether or not they commonly cost you way more charge for that solution.

Loans created by pawnbrokers was regulated on county height inside the Georgia, however, local governing bodies can enforce stricter limitations. Pawn shops try signed up from the state and you can civil governments and you can tracked by the regional cops or sheriff’s departmentplaints in the pawn storage is be advertised towards appropriate regional the police expert.
